I can't speak on maaco from 7 years ago. I know their quality has gone down the crapper as they've expanded. cheap *** sikkens paint or other, 1 stage job, almost ZERO prep work, over spray all over your window moldings, and orange peel everywhere. that Miata looks great and if you do all the prep work yourself and mask it off really well I'm sure they can do a satisfactory paint job. but as far as for resale value, leave the factory paint on there so the new owner can decide what they want to do with it. if I was looking at a car with a maaco "paint job" on it I'd ask him to lower the price because I'll have to remove all that crap paint before I can repaint it

yes a maaco paint job will certainly increase value for someone who doesn't care about how it looks long term, or doesn't know what they're looking at
